Doig III :Updated: $Date: 2009-04-02 10:57:29 -0700 (Thu, 02 Apr 2009) $ Creative Commons provides web service APIs which can be used to integrate the Creative Commons licensing engine into third party applications. The following versions are available: .. toctree:: :maxdepth: 1 1.0 1.5 Development The current in-development API is described in the :doc:`development version documentation `. These APIs are currently in beta, and we are soliciting feedback and suggestions. As such, the API may change in the future. Sample Code ~~~~~~~~~~~ ccPublisher uses the REST interface. See class CcRest in wizard/pages/license.py for an example. Other example usages: * Python: The ccwsclient package provides basic abstraction of the REST interface via a Python class (`ccwsclient SVN`_). * Java: The org.creativecommons.api package provides the CcRest class for using the REST web service from Java. Relies on JDOM and Jaxen. (`org.cc.api SVN`_) Your comments, feedback and suggestions can be sent to software@creativecommons.org.
